// The Quotaline client below enforces per-tenant rate quotas for the
// Fernwick billing tier service. Each tenant gets a rolling 60-second
// window; bursts above the quota are queued, not dropped, so do not
// add retry logic here or you will double-count requests. If you change
// the window size, update the matching value in the Quotaline admin
// console or tenants will see phantom throttling. The client
// authenticates with the key on the next line.

service key, fawip-bajef: kto11_Qt5wZK9vdNC

CI note for VramScope plugin authors: the profiler shard on runner pool grav-7 now requires allocator hooks to be registered before device init. If your plugin samples GPU memory mid-kernel, rebuild against the Korvane SDK 3.2 headers or traces will truncate silently. Verify your run against the reference trace token below.

session token of tajef-bageg = htk21_5d90d574934f3ccae6437

Config is read from `.env` in the package root. Required: `FIXTURESMITH_SEED` (integer, pins generation order), `FIXTURESMITH_LOCALE` (defaults to `kv-KV`), and `FIXTURESMITH_OUTPUT_DIR`. Release builds also need the artifact store enabled via `FIXTURESMITH_STORE=remote`. Do not commit `.env`; the pipeline injects its own copy. For local verification before cutting a release, set the store credentials yourself. After the lines above, add the store access token on its own line:

env line for kaguf-hahop: COURIER_KEY29=2e2fa9479f98362396e2c28f86fc9

MEMO — Branch Managers

Re: Halvard Street lease renegotiation.

Landlord agreed to a five-year extension with a capped escalator. Fit-out credit still under discussion. Do not commit to layout changes at any branch until terms are signed. Questions go to Priya Ostwell by Wednesday. The reasoning behind our position is set out in the note below.

board note of kageg-bahof: The renewal with Holwynax Holdings closes at $2 million a year, 5 percent below the last contract. Project Ulaath slips by two quarters because of the supplier delay.